package io.fabric8.crd.generator.utils;
import io.fabric8.kubernetes.api.builder.Builder;
import io.fabric8.kubernetes.api.builder.VisitableBuilder;
import io.fabric8.kubernetes.api.model.HasMetadata;
import io.fabric8.kubernetes.api.model.ObjectMeta;
import io.fabric8.kubernetes.api.model.ObjectMetaFluent;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.util.Optional;
import java.util.function.Predicate;
public class Metadata {
private Metadata() {
throw new IllegalStateException("Utility class");
}
public static Optional getKind(Builder builder) {
try {
Method method = builder.getClass().getMethod("getKind");
Object o = method.invoke(builder);
if (o instanceof String) {
return Optional.of((String) o);
}
} catch (NoSuchMethodException | IllegalAccessException | InvocationTargetException e) {
//ignore
}
return Optional.empty();
}
public static Optional getMetadata(Builder builder) {
try {
Method method = builder.getClass().getMethod("buildMetadata");
Object o = method.invoke(builder);
if (o instanceof ObjectMeta) {
return Optional.of((ObjectMeta) o);
}
} catch (NoSuchMethodException | IllegalAccessException | InvocationTargetException e) {
//ignore
}
return Optional.empty();
}
public static boolean addToLabels(Builder builder, String key, String value) {
try {
Method editMethod = builder.getClass().getMethod("editOrNewMetadata");
Object o = editMethod.invoke(builder);
if (o instanceof ObjectMetaFluent) {
ObjectMetaFluent fluent = (ObjectMetaFluent) o;
fluent.addToLabels(key, value);
Method endMethod = fluent.getClass().getMethod("endMetadata");
endMethod.invoke(fluent);
return true;
}
} catch (NoSuchMethodException | IllegalAccessException | InvocationTargetException e) {
//ignore
}
return false;
}
public static boolean removeFromLabels(Builder builder, String key) {
try {
Method editMethod = builder.getClass().getMethod("editOrNewMetadata");
Object o = editMethod.invoke(builder);
if (o instanceof ObjectMetaFluent) {
ObjectMetaFluent fluent = (ObjectMetaFluent) o;
fluent.removeFromLabels(key);
Method endMethod = fluent.getClass().getMethod("endMetadata");
endMethod.invoke(fluent);
return true;
}
} catch (NoSuchMethodException | IllegalAccessException | InvocationTargetException e) {
//ignore
}
return false;
}
/**
* Create a {@link Predicate} that checks that a resource builder doesn't match the name and kind.
*
* @param candidate The specified resource.
* @return The predicate.
*/
public static Predicate> matching(
HasMetadata candidate) {
return matching(candidate.getApiVersion(), candidate.getKind(),
candidate.getMetadata().getName());
}
/**
* Create a {@link Predicate} that checks that a resource builder doesn't match the name and kind.
*
* @param apiVersion the API version the resources must match
* @param kind The specified kind.
* @param name The specified name.
* @return The predicate.
*/
public static Predicate> matching(String apiVersion,
String kind, String name) {
return builder -> {
HasMetadata item = builder.build();
ObjectMeta metadata = item.getMetadata();
return apiVersion.equals(item.getApiVersion()) &&
kind != null && kind.equals(item.getKind()) &&
name != null && name.equals(metadata.getName());
};
}
}
